Free Trial, Free Version, and Money Back guarantee: What’s the difference?

Trying out a premium-level service without having to pay is a good way to test out a few options and see which one is the best for you.

VPN companies offer three main options: a free trial, a money-back guarantee, and a free version. Let’s discuss the difference between these 3:

➡️ Free trial
Free trial versions offer the benefits of software for a limited period of time. Most offer the whole feature package, but some VPNs do exclude certain options.

Users get to try out all the features included without having to pay beforehand. The trial periods, but the most common are 7 -day trials, 14-day trials, and 30-day trials.

Some VPN services require credit card information and other details needed to activate the subscription. In this case, it is very important to read the terms of service.

Many users have had the unpleasant surprise of being automatically charged once the trial period ended. At that point, there’s not much you can do if you agree to it.

➡️ Money-back guarantee
This is yet another very common way VPN services get customers to try out their products. In this case, however, you will have to pay beforehand.

The money-back-guarantee model ensures that if you are not satisfied with the product, you will be reimbursed. The guarantee is valid for a limited period of time.

VPN services offer up to 45-days money-back guarantees. The most common validity period is however 30 days. 

In this case, it is even more important to carefully read the terms of service. Some VPN services will allow you to cancel your subscription and give you the money-back no questions asked.

On the other hand, others may ask you to provide the reasoning behind your decision. In this case, it may be less likely that you will actually get your money back.

➡️ Free version
Some software companies that offer paid products launch a limited version of said products that is available for free. 

As opposed to a free trial or a money-back guarantee, in this case, you will not get all the features and benefits of the paid plans.

VPN services with free versions generally limit data. Most have a daily or weekly data limit. If you exceed it, you will have to pay to get more data or wait for renewal.

Other limitations come in the type and number of servers you access. Chances are that you will not connect to the same servers that premium users get.

There are some free VPN versions that will limit how many times you are allowed to switch between servers on a daily or weekly basis.

For the most part, for a free version, you won’t have to add card info. However, some ask you to create an account, but that’s about it.

Do free trial VPNs and free VPNs include all features you need?

Trial versions with expiration dates use to include all premium features. You can really test out the product. Free versions, on the other hand, are a bit of a different story.

The most common reasons people choose to use a VPN are data protection, faster Internet, and access to geo-blocked sites and services.

Many free VPN apps meet all these requirements. On the other hand, they are more restrictive. You get most features but you can’t benefit from them without limits.

🔒 Data protection: Free VPNs use up-to-date encryption algorithms like AES-256 and ChaCha20. Plus, many of this software give access to secure protocols like OpenVPN, IKEv2, and WireGuard.

That being said, the free versions may not include are security features like double VPN (routing traffic through 2 servers) or a secure killswitch. 

Plus, not all free VPNs have 0 logs policy. Some record some of your data and sell it to third parties. That’s how they are able to provide the service for free.

Faster Internet: using a VPN can improve connection speed. That is because you can connect to a server that is closer in location to the game or service you want to access. They also hide your traffic data, avoiding ISP throttling and bandwidth limitations.

The free versions can offer fast connections, but that’s up until you run out of a limited amount of data. 

Some VPN services only let you connect to their faster servers if you buy a subscription. It is also very common for a free VPN server to get overpopulated at times, which reduces speed rates.

🌎 Surpass Geo Restricted Content: VPNs with international servers enable access to geo-blocked websites and platforms for video on demand or other services. Free VPNs do not have such a large server base, but they can grant you access.

As you can see, for some VPNs, we divided up their plans because not all of them have the same type of free trial/money-back guarantee. Plus, in some cases, the way they advertise these plans can be confusing.

Some VPNs offer 7-day free trials for mobile. But if you try to get it from your computer, you’ll be directed to a subscription plan page and you will have to pay (and qualify for the money-back guarantee).

We suppose they do so because you generally use up fewer traffic data on your mobile. That means that their paying subscribers are less likely to experience performance issues caused by overpopulated servers.

For example, if you sign up for an ExpressVPN account on mobile, you can benefit from a 7-day free trial. But if you sign up from your PC, you’ll have to get a subscription with a money-back guarantee.

We first checked the Express VPN website from a PC and saw that they claim to offer a free trial. But whenever we tried to access it, we were directed to its premium plans that ask you to pay in advance.

That’s why we decided to check their mobile app and were able to get a 7-day free trial without paying anything.

Are free VPNs as safe as premium ones?

We mentioned in the beginning that some free VPNs keep data logs and sell them to third parties. That is a problem if you want to browse completely anonymously.

The good news is, that most VPNs clearly state whether they keep logs or not, and there are free VPNs that can be trusted.

🔒 Privacy Policy
The privacy policies of free VPNs do however protect your actual identity and whereabouts. They generally sell traffic data for advertising companies which are mostly concerned with demographic information like gender and age.

If you don’t have a major problem with that, then you don’t risk getting tracked down. Even though they log your data, they still hide your IP address and prevent your ISP from throttling your traffic.

📈 Data limit
Another privacy risk that can occur with a free VPN is the data limit. Most free VPNs have a daily or monthly usage limit.  When that is exceeded, you are no longer covered by the VPN.

Some of these VPNs do not alert you when you reach your data limit and simply disconnect you. That can be a problem especially if you use a VPN for online payments or other similar tasks that require high levels of privacy and protection.

🛡️ Security features
Free VPNs may also not include some very advanced security features like DNS protection, split-tunneling, a secure killswitch, and anti-tracking tools. 

All in all, free VPNs are not as secure, but they still provide solid privacy protection. It is very important to carefully read all the Terms of service and make sure you do not agree to any suspicious catch.

Can you prolong a free trial for VPN?

You can generally prolong a free trial by request. Software companies, including those that distribute VPN apps, generally mention how this works in their particular case in the Terms of use.

For the most part, however, you have to come up with a pretty solid reason for them to even consider this request.

That being said, there are some other ways to prolong a free trial. Keep in mind that they do not work for all software, especially for those that require registration.

Some users suggest that if you completely remove the VPN app from your PC, you may be able to get a free trial again. Cleaning browsing history and cookies may also work.

Keep in mind that software manufacturers try to stop this type of behavior and use different methods to stop you from re-using their free trials.

How can you get your money back after your free trial has expired?

As soon as your trial ends, services with auto-renewal will start charging you. If you provided your credit card information and forgot to cancel the trial before the expiration date, you can contact the customer support team and explain the situation.

Most VPN services have 24/7 live chat support on their official website. You can talk to an agent about your issue. They should know exactly how to apply their policy to your specific situation.

The bad news is that it is not very likely for a refund to occur. We cannot stress enough the importance of reading the Terms of Service Agreement.

Chances are that the refund policy is mentioned there somewhere. Most software state that they do not give money back. If you agreed to that, there’s probably not much you can do.

For this reason, it’s best you cancel it before the expiration date. Likewise, if you are on a money-back guarantee, it’s recommended you request a refund before you hit the last day.
